Preparing Firecracker Ground Chicken

Cooking should be a fun and rewarding experience, right? If you’re looking for a tantalizing meal that packs a punch but is still simple enough for a weeknight dinner, Firecracker Ground Chicken should be at the top of your list. Let’s walk through how to prepare it step-by-step.

Gather Your Ingredients

First things first, let’s make sure you have everything you need. For this spicy dish, your ingredient list should include:

  • 1 pound of ground chicken
  • 2 tablespoons of olive oil
  • 2-3 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on of fresh ginger, minced
  • 1 bell pepper (red or green), diced
  • 1/4 cup of green onions, chopped
  • 1/4 cup of low-sodium chicken broth
  • 1 tablespoon of soy sauce (or tamari for gluten-free)
  • 1 tablespoon of rice v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on of sriracha (more for additional heat)
  • 1 tablespoon of honey or maple syrup
  • Cooked rice (for serving)

Make sure to prep everything before you start cooking. You’ll appreciate the efficiency once you dive in – and it also means less stress!

Heat the Skillet

Once your ingredients are laid out, it’s time to heat your skillet. Grab a large skillet or frying pan and pour in the olive oil. Turn the heat to medium-high. It’s essential to let the oil get hot enough before adding your chicken. For a quick test, drop a tiny bit of water in the pan – if it sizzles, you’re ready to go!

Brown the Chicken

Next, add the ground chicken to the skillet. You want to break it up with a spatula as it cooks, allowing it to brown evenly. This typically takes around 5-7 minutes. As the chicken cooks, it will release some moisture, making it easier to sauté.

Add in your minced garlic and ginger during the last minute of cooking. These aromatics will add a wonderful depth of flavor to your Firecracker Ground Chicken.

Whisk the Firecracker Sauce

While the chicken is browning, let’s whip up that Firecracker Sauce. In a small bowl, combine the chicken broth, soy sauce, rice vinegar, sriracha, and honey. Whisk everything together until it’s smoothly blended. You’ll notice how the sweet and spicy ingredients come together to create that delightful firecracker flavor!

If you’re interested in more about balancing sweet and spicy flavors, you might want to check out Serious Eats for helpful tips.

Combine Chicken and Sauce

With your chicken nicely browned and your sauce ready to go, it’s time for the magic to happen. Pour the Firecracker Sauce over the ground chicken in the skillet, stirring thoroughly to coat every morsel. Allow it to simmer for an additional 3-5 minutes, letting all those flavors meld together perfectly.

Toss in the diced bell pepper and half of the green onions and stir until everything is well combined. This will add a lovely crunch and freshness, balancing the spiciness beautifully.

Plate and Serve

Now, the moment you’ve been waiting for! Grab your cooked rice and serve it in bowls, topping it generously with your delicious Firecracker Ground Chicken. Finish with a sprinkle of the remaining green onions for an extra pop of color and flavor.

Firecracker Ground Chicken: An Easy, Flavor-Packed Delight

Discover how to make a delicious and easy Firecracker Ground Chicken that is packed with flavor and perfect for any meal.

  • Author: Souzan
  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Category: Main Dish
  • Method: Stovetop
  • Cuisine: Asian
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ground chicken
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 1 tablespoon sriracha
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on ginger, minced
  • 2 green onions,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il

Instructions

  1. In a skillet, heat sesame oil over medium heat.
  2. Add garlic and ginger, s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.
  3. Add ground chicken, cook until browned.
  4. Stir in soy sauce, honey, and sriracha, and cook for an additional 5 minutes.
  5. Garnish with green onions and serve.

Notes

  • This dish can be served over rice or in lettuce wraps.
  • Adjust the level of sriracha for desired spiciness.
